The birth year was listed as 1956. Public records show Richmond as a city Debra also stayed in. Debra is related to or closely associated with Mary Prah Sholley, James E Wagner, James L Lipscomb and one other person. Debra has listed phone number: (804) 271-4092. The current age of Debra is 68. Debra now resides at 8649 Pleasant Ridge Rd, Richmond, Va 23237.